Overview for Bushrod, CA

7,573 people live in Bushrod, where the median age is 36 and the average individual income is $58,399.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.

Welcome to Bushrod

 
Tucked between the lively neighborhoods of North Oakland and Temescal, Bushrod is a charming and diverse area that blends residential tranquility with urban convenience. Known for its tree-lined streets and welcoming atmosphere, Bushrod offers a neighborhood feel that’s both relaxed and connected, making it an appealing option for those looking for a peaceful home base with easy access to Oakland’s hot spots.
 
At the heart of Bushrod is Bushrod Park, a central gathering place where the community comes together for everything from picnics to sports games. The park features lush green spaces, sports fields, and playgrounds, making it a popular destination for families and outdoor enthusiasts. The community also hosts a variety of events here, further fostering the neighborhood’s close-knit vibe.
 
While Bushrod maintains a quiet residential charm, it’s just moments away from the action in neighboring districts like Temescal and Rockridge. Whether you're craving a delicious meal at local favorites like Bakesale Betty or exploring the shops and cafes in Temescal Alley, the area offers plenty of dining, shopping, and cultural options. This proximity makes Bushrod an ideal spot for those who want a peaceful home but enjoy being close to the energy of Oakland’s trendier districts.
 
Bushrod also stands out for its diverse community, which is reflected in the variety of cultural offerings throughout the neighborhood. From Mi Tierra Restaurant, serving authentic Mexican dishes, to Café Madeleine, where you can enjoy a fresh pastry and coffee, the area’s rich mix of backgrounds gives it a unique and vibrant character. As the neighborhood continues to evolve with new businesses and energy, Bushrod is quickly becoming one of Oakland’s most up-and-coming spots, offering the perfect balance of history, community, and modern-day amenities.
